Originally Posted by s3v3n
SD card only contains map data. The unit contains firmware and software application so it's a separate update.
That's correct...the micro SD card only holds Map data...the unit software is updated via the USB port.
Mind you it doesn't take 2.5 hours, but between getting the vehicle into the shop, doing the update, washing the vehicle, and then returning it to the customer, 2.5 hours can pass in the blink of an eye.
The actual software update of the unit only takes a a handful of minutes.

Originally Posted by enkrypt3d
what do you do with your gas cap while refueling? let it dangle?
No. There’s a place for it on the fuel door. Look for a circular cut-out/post on the top of the hinge part. The cap fits on top of it (took me awhile to figure that out too).
